Why do identity governance processes break down when organisations rely on outdated workflows?

Outdated workflows fail because they rarely cover every system, depend on manual updates, and force teams to stitch together data from multiple tools. That creates delays, inconsistent records, and missed exceptions. When governance cannot keep pace with access changes, security teams spend more time firefighting and less time reducing risk.

Why This Matters for Security Teams

identity governance breaks down fastest when the process model is older than the environment it is meant to control. Manual reviews, quarterly access recertifications, and spreadsheet-led exception handling may have worked when access changed slowly, but they do not keep pace with cloud services, machine identities, and AI-driven workflows. That gap creates blind spots, stale entitlements, and delayed revocation.

For NHI programs, this is not just an efficiency issue. Outdated workflows often miss service accounts, API keys, tokens, and automation paths that never pass through human onboarding and offboarding steps. The risk is compounded when teams treat identity governance as a periodic audit task instead of a continuous control.

Current guidance from the NIST Cybersecurity Framework 2.0 points toward continuous risk management, but many organisations still operate with approval chains that assume static ownership and stable entitlements. In practice, many security teams encounter stale access only after an incident review reveals that no one owned the exception process end to end.

How It Works in Practice

Modern governance needs to follow the identity lifecycle, not the calendar. That means discovering every identity, classifying whether it is human or non-human, mapping ownership, and tying access decisions to actual system usage. For NHIs, this includes credentials issued to workloads, integrations, robots, scripts, CI/CD pipelines, and AI agents. If the inventory is incomplete, the governance process will be incomplete too.

Effective programs usually combine four mechanics: automated discovery, ownership assignment, policy-based approvals, and continuous entitlement review. The Ultimate Guide to NHIs describes why lifecycle process coverage matters, especially where provisioning, rotation, and revocation need to happen without waiting for a manual ticket. The NIST Cybersecurity Framework 2.0 reinforces the need to identify assets, manage access, and monitor for change continuously rather than intermittently.

  • Inventory all identities, including service accounts, API tokens, and automated integrations.
  • Assign accountable owners for each identity and secret.
  • Replace manual approval chains with policy-driven workflows for common requests.
  • Automate revocation when a workload, integration, or project ends.
  • Reconcile logs, entitlement data, and usage telemetry to detect drift.

This is where old processes fail most often: they assume the identity request is the same thing as the identity lifecycle, when in reality the highest risk appears after issuance, during rotation, reuse, and decommissioning. These controls tend to break down when entitlements are spread across multiple clouds and SaaS platforms because no single workflow sees the full access path.

Common Variations and Edge Cases

Tighter governance often increases operational overhead, requiring organisations to balance stronger control against the speed of business and the burden on platform teams. Best practice is evolving, especially where shared service accounts, ephemeral workloads, and delegated automation are involved. There is no universal standard for every environment yet, so the governance model needs to match the technical reality of the estate.

Some environments can centralise identity workflows cleanly, while others cannot. Mergers, legacy applications, and shadow IT often leave teams with multiple directories, duplicated roles, and exceptions that were never formally retired. In those cases, the right answer is usually not another manual review cycle. It is better discovery, clearer ownership, and tighter linkage between access and usage. Audit teams should also distinguish between compliance evidence and actual control performance. A completed certification is not proof that access was correct, only that someone reviewed a record at a point in time. Where automation is partial, the safest approach is to treat manual workflows as temporary compensating controls rather than a durable operating model.
